Alberta reports 126 new COVID-19 cases on Wednesday
Alberta is reporting 126 new confirmed COVID-19 infections on Wednesday, bringing the total to 1,996.
There are no new virus-related fatalities as that total for the province remains 48.
Premier Jason Kenney said Alberta continues testing at a higher rate than other provinces. With 2,853 tests being completed in the last day alone, 82,534 Albertans have been tested for COVID-19.
There are currently 44 hospitalizations from COVID-19, including 10 in ICU.
